Tell us about a time when you analyzed test data to inform design modifications and enhancements.
Farm Equipment Engineer Interview Questions
Sample answer to the question
In my previous role as a Junior Farm Equipment Engineer, I was involved in a project to enhance the performance of a tractor. We conducted multiple tests to gather data on various aspects of the tractor's operation, such as fuel efficiency, power output, and handling. I analyzed the test data by comparing it to the performance benchmarks and identifying areas where improvements could be made. Based on the analysis, we made design modifications to the fuel injection system and implemented a more efficient cooling system. These enhancements resulted in a 10% increase in fuel efficiency and better overall performance of the tractor. My role was to analyze the test data, collaborate with senior engineers to propose design modifications, and assist in implementing those changes.

An exceptional answer
During my previous role as a Junior Farm Equipment Engineer, I was involved in a project to analyze test data and inform design modifications for a self-propelled sprayer. This project aimed to improve the sprayer's overall performance and maximize the precision of chemical application. To accomplish this, we conducted extensive field tests to collect data on factors such as spraying accuracy, coverage uniformity, and operational efficiency. I managed the entire testing process, including setting up the experiment, collecting data using specialized sensors and devices, and ensuring accurate data recording. Once the data was collected, I performed thorough statistical analysis, using techniques such as regression analysis and ANOVA to identify the key factors affecting spray performance. Based on the analysis, I proposed design modifications, including optimizing the spray nozzle configuration and improving the control system to enhance spray precision. These modifications resulted in a 20% improvement in chemical application accuracy and a reduction in chemical wastage by 15%. Additionally, I collaborated closely with a multidisciplinary team, including senior engineers, agronomists, and technicians, to communicate the findings and proposed design modifications effectively. We held regular meetings to discuss the test results, share insights, and gather valuable input from team members. My role as a team leader involved coordinating the testing activities, managing the data analysis process, and presenting the results and recommendations to the wider team and management.
Why this is an exceptional answer:
The exceptional answer goes above and beyond by providing even more specific details and quantifiable results. It demonstrates the candidate's ability to manage the entire testing process, apply advanced statistical analysis techniques, and lead a multidisciplinary team. The candidate also emphasizes their strong communication and teamwork capabilities by highlighting their collaboration with various stakeholders. Overall, the exceptional answer excels in showcasing the candidate's analytical thinking and problem-solving skills, knowledge of engineering principles and design processes, ability to perform laboratory and field testing on equipment, and strong communication and teamwork capabilities.
How to prepare for this question
- Familiarize yourself with statistical analysis techniques commonly used in engineering, such as regression analysis and ANOVA.
- Practice analyzing and interpreting test data from previous projects or case studies.
- Research the specific components or equipment relevant to the target job and understand their design principles and performance metrics.
- Gain experience in conducting laboratory and field tests on equipment, and be prepared to discuss your role in these activities.
- Improve your communication and collaboration skills by actively participating in team-based projects and presentations.
What interviewers are evaluating
- Analytical thinking and problem-solving
- Knowledge of engineering principles and design processes
- Ability to perform laboratory and field testing on equipment
- Strong communication and teamwork capabilities
